Since it's a portable drive and it's bound to be bumped and maybe even dropped, I'd get one with a longer warranty.
 
If you want portability, go with a 2.5" enclosure. If you want capacities beyond 160GB(200-250GB are nearing release though), go with a 3.5" enclosure. Most of them perform about the same as far as speeds go. They're mostly limited by USB/Firewire bandwidths, which are something liek 30-40MB/s. Go for an enclosure with a reputable bridge chip, such as Cypress, NEC, Oxford Semi, Genesys.
